Output edb4e2df80a85776da5230da896f9e7da9a6fc222359077b0fc864f53846ea86:4

value
3205996
script pubkey
OP_0 OP_PUSHBYTES_20 ec502a6fb1b08420987273e99544676981dc72b2
address
bc1qa3gz5ma3kzzzpxrjw05e23r8dxqacu4j735ukl
transaction
edb4e2df80a85776da5230da896f9e7da9a6fc222359077b0fc864f53846ea86
confirmations
103032
spent
true